MINUTES — Management Meeting, Heads of Department

Attendees reviewed the proposal to outsource Tier 1 customer support to Quillbrook Services, based in Marden Falls. Finance confirmed projected savings of 14% against current staffing. HR raised retention concerns for the Elsworth call centre; a redeployment plan will be drafted before any decision. Legal flagged data-handling clauses requiring revision. A pilot covering the Corvane product line was approved in principle, pending board sign-off. The confidential planning note follows below:

board note of bawep-tajef: Queniusek Systems plans to raise the Quenvan list price by 53.1 percent in March. The pricing group signed off on a budget of $176.4 million for Project Drueth. The renewal with Casionix Partners closes at $142.5 million a year, 8.3 percent below the last contract. Project Fraax slips by six weeks because of the tooling delay.

## Account Recovery — Trailnote Offline Mode

When a surveyor's Trailnote app has been offline for 30+ days, their local credentials expire and sync refuses to resume. Don't make them wipe the device — all their unsynced field data lives there! Instead, open the support console, pick "Offline Reinstate," and enter their handle. The console will ask for the support team's shared recovery passphrase before issuing a reinstatement token. Use the one below.

unlock words, bagaf-fajeg: zorael-kelax-fraath-quenix-eliok-sileth-aldmir-wenir-druiel

Changelog — Lattice UI library v4.2.0: The setting formerly named PUBLISH_KEY is now REGISTRY_PUBLISH_TOKEN to match our registry's terminology. Old name is rejected as of this release; CI fails loudly rather than falling back. Update every consuming repo's env file accordingly. For reference, the renamed entry should appear in the file right after this line.

sealed setting: ARCHIVE_KEY3=8d0

## Onboarding: Farebranch Rules Engine

Plugin authors integrate with Farebranch by registering fee rules against the evaluation API. Rules are sandboxed; they cannot perform network calls directly. All rate-table lookups go through the host, which validates your plugin manifest at load time. Your local env file must include the signing credential the host uses to verify manifests, set on the next line.

secret setting of bajef-fajof: COURIER_KEY3=76c